Srinath survives Fahlke storm
Second seed Prahlad Srinath survived a Teutonic barrage, wordy turbulence and an opponent as sporting as a lion whose tail had been stepped upon, in the $6250 State Bank of India ITF Satellite Circuit Tennis Tournament.

Chinese knocks out Gopi in 2nd round
India's Pullela Gopi Chand was eliminated from the World Grand Prix series Badminton Tournament in Denmark on Thursday, losing 2-15 11-15 in the second round to Dong Jiong of China.

Ghei fires sub-par round on day one
Gaurav Ghei was the only Indian among eight to record below par opening round, while towering Australian John Senden fired a 4 under par 67 to share the lead in the $200,000 Omega Tour's Kuala Lumpur golf in Kuala Lumpur.
